Property Description for 68 Garden Street, B-5A

Welcome to 68 Garden Street #B5A, a spacious two-bedroom, two-bathroom with washer and dryer in unit. The apartment features two oversized bedrooms that can easily accommodate king-sized beds in each room. The main bedroom has a large en-suite bathroom that is equipped with deep-soaking tubs. The kitchen has all new appliances and granite countertops. The pass-through window is great for entertaining. Building amenities include a large private courtyard and a fitness center. Along with these amenities, residents are steps away from transportation that is provided by the J, M, Z subway lines at Broadway and Flushing Avenues. The building does not allow subletting until 2033 and the units must be occupied as primary residences. The following income guidelines must be followed. Maximum Gross Annual Income (to purchase), as follows: Household of 1 $ 108,680 Household of 2 $ 124,150 Household of 3 $ 139,620 Household of 4 $ 155,090 Income Eligible Buyers will be determined by proof of income with current pay stubs. Household income includes gross pay, overtime pay, part-time pay, bonuses, commissions, tips, dividends, interest, royalties, trust income, net rental income, VA compensation, pension, Social Security benefits, unemployment benefits, alimony, child support, public assistance, sick pay, business income, investment income, and other income of purchaser and any other of purchaser’s household members who will reside in the unit. Bushwick | Brooklyn

Quick Profile

As one of the most diverse neighborhoods in New York, Bushwick offers a perfect snapshot of just how multicultural the city is. Long-established as an amalgam of cultures and ethnicities, a wave of varying types of immigrants trickled in from the seventeenth to twentieth centuries, with Bushwick largely becoming a home to Hispanics of Puerto Rican and Dominican backgrounds by the latter part of the twentieth century. 

With the Bushwick Initiative of the mid-00s that aided in revitalization, it became an attractive area to young professionals and artists. And even now, Bushwick has sustained affordable rent prices where other North Brooklyn counterparts, like Williamsburg and Greenpoint, have become more expensive. Priding itself on the weird and the wacky, numerous art collectives thrive in this part of Brooklyn, once famously named the seventh coolest neighborhood in the world by Vogue. 

Though it has drawn in many tourists in recent years (there’s even a graffiti tour you can take from the Bushwick Collective), the neighborhood remains very much community-oriented, and has not been subject to quite the same sort of corporate infiltration phenomenon of its nearby Williamsburg environs. 

But yes, of course, Bushwick has come a very long way from its 80s and 90s reputation as being “The Well,” a nickname given to it for its free-flowing and widely available amount of drugs (quantity over quality being the cliche applied here).
